MasukAfter discovering her husband’s affair and losing the child she waited six years for, Seraphina Ashborne decides to walk away from the life she sacrificed everything to protect. But as her husband desperately tries to win her back, old friends, political figures, and hidden ambitions begin pulling her into a far bigger conflict than a broken marriage. In the end, Seraphina must choose between love, power, and herself.
